BPilgrim ... The cases can be repaired, but as you pointed out you need to find someone who knows what they are doing. I repaired a similar failure on one of the 348's I purchased with a metal based epoxy, but I had all the pieces and merely had to 'glue' them back in place along with some extra epoxy for reinforcement. It's lasted more than 3 years at this point.
